DetailsDescription:
On database connection errors freeradius fails to reconnect and all database connections become stale. No authentication is possible in this situation. The issue has been reported to freeradius mailing list [0] and the issue is reported to be fixed in git [1]. Looks like "Don't recusively grab mutexes." [2] is what fixes the issue. Possibly we need some of the follow-up commits as well.
